Transaction

85c6915b61ab05310b5b1537a9530d84011c04dfd1461151cd6c37845622eb37

Summary

In Block321722
TimeMon, 21 Aug 2023 08:05:30 UTC
Total Input2203.46230736 Nebula
Total Output2258.46230736 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
385663 Confirmations2258.46230736 Nebula
Raw Transaction